Zooming and panning slightly left would have made this composition. It would have placed Big Ben off-centre in the shot brought the interesting elements closer and would have excluded the irrelevant items such as the dark object in the foreground and some of the less interesting buildings on the right.

Nice time of day and colour though, so it's still a pleasing shot.

The focus here looks a bit soft, and the setting sun is blown out at the right of the tower. Also, the subject is dead center of the photo. I'm not a rule of thirds hardliner, but it would have been helpful here.
